Roseanne Barr Bites Back at Anti-Trump Hysteric Rob Reiner on Twitter Over How Elections Work

Actress and comedienne Roseanne Barr fired back Sunday at director Rob Reiner on X (formerly Twitter), responding to his latest complaint about former President Trump and the future of the United States.

The anti-Trump hysteric Reiner attacked Republicans for continuing to support Trump despite his legal challenges and essentially predicted the end of the world if Democrats did not win the presidency in 2024.

“Let this sink in. Republicans say that even if Trump is a Convicted Felon who attempted to destroy American Democracy, they will still vote for him. We will only survive if he, and the corrupt party he leads, is decisively defeated in 2024,” Reiner posted.

Barr responded, “What a crazy idea, you mean beat him in a fair and general election that would require good ideas and debate (and not so obvious corruption)??? Lol, Good luck dems.”

“We know why you’re cheating and lying and indicting and false flagging,” Barr continued. “It’s your only hope. But keep telling us we are the threat to democracy.”

The Republican National Committee (RNC) shared a comment on Sunday, pointing out that “Since taking office, Joe Biden has spent 380 days – 39.9 percent of his presidency – on vacation.”

“Imagine how much worse things would be if he was working every day,” Barr quipped in return.
